Prepare Smoked Paprika Chicken Breasts
Seasoning for flavor
The first step in crafting our smoked paprika chicken alfredo is to infuse the chicken breasts with their signature flavor. Begin by patting your boneless, skinless chicken breasts dry with paper towels; this helps create a better sear. In a small bowl, combine a generous amount of smoked paprika with garlic powder, onion powder, salt, and black pepper. Thoroughly rub this spice mixture over both sides of each chicken breast, ensuring an even coating. This meticulous seasoning process is crucial for developing a deep, aromatic flavor that permeates the chicken, making it a truly flavorful chicken component of the dish.
Cooking to perfection
Once seasoned, the chicken is ready to be cooked to juicy perfection. Heat a large skillet over medium-high heat with a drizzle of olive oil. Add the seasoned chicken breasts to the hot skillet, being careful not to overcrowd the pan; cook in batches if necessary. Sear the chicken for about 5-7 minutes per side, or until it develops a beautiful golden-brown crust and is cooked through to an internal temperature of 165°F (74°C). The goal is tender, moist chicken that is packed with smoky paprika flavor. Once cooked, remove the chicken from the skillet and let it rest on a cutting board for a few minutes before slicing, allowing the juices to redistribute for maximum tenderness. Creamy Parmesan Alfredo Sauce Base
Heating cream gently
Creating the perfect creamy sauce base for our unique alfredo starts with patience and gentle heat. In a medium saucepan, pour in the heavy cream. Place the saucepan over medium-low heat. It is crucial to heat the cream gently, allowing it to warm through slowly without coming to a rolling boil. Gentle heating prevents the cream from scorching and ensures a smooth, luscious texture for your sauce. Keep stirring occasionally to distribute the heat evenly. This step lays the foundation for a truly indulgent and velvety sauce that will perfectly complement the flavorful chicken. We love rich sauces in the main course category.
Melting Parmesan cheese
Once the heavy cream is gently warmed, it’s time to incorporate the star of the classic Alfredo: Parmesan cheese. Gradually add freshly grated Parmesan cheese to the warm cream, stirring constantly with a whisk. Continue stirring until the cheese has completely melted into the cream, forming a smooth, lump-free sauce. The key here is not to rush the process; allow the cheese to melt slowly and integrate fully, which helps create that signature silken consistency. Avoid high heat during this stage, as it can cause the cheese to clump or the sauce to break. This Parmesan base provides the essential richness before we introduce our Mediterranean twist.
Add Feta and Tahini for Flavor Explosion
Mixing feta and tahini
This is where our smoked paprika chicken alfredo truly transforms into a unique alfredo with a Mediterranean twist. In a small bowl, combine the crumbled feta cheese with the tahini. Use a fork or a small whisk to mix them thoroughly, creating a thick, somewhat chunky paste. The feta provides a salty, tangy counterpoint, while the tahini brings a rich, nutty, and slightly bitter undertone. This combination might seem unconventional for an Alfredo, but it introduces a depth of flavor that is both intriguing and incredibly delicious, moving beyond a standard creamy chicken alfredo recipe. Combining with cream sauce
Once your feta and tahini mixture is ready, gently fold it into your warm Parmesan Alfredo sauce base. Stir carefully until the feta-tahini mixture is well incorporated, distributing its distinct flavors throughout the creamy sauce. The sauce will take on a slightly thicker consistency and a beautiful, complex aroma. Taste and adjust seasoning if necessary, keeping in mind the saltiness of the feta. This fusion creates a sauce that is rich, tangy, nutty, and wonderfully savory, providing a truly unique alfredo experience that perfectly balances the smoky chicken and roasted vegetables. Preparing Roasted Brussels and Potatoes
Cutting sprouts and wedges
To ensure our roasted vegetables reach golden perfection, proper preparation is key. Begin by washing the Brussels sprouts thoroughly. Trim off the tough ends and remove any discolored outer leaves. For smaller sprouts, you can leave them whole, but for larger ones, cut them in half through the stem. This ensures even cooking and more surface area for caramelization. For the potatoes, we recommend using Yukon Gold or red potatoes for their creamy texture when roasted. Wash them well, and then cut them into uniform 1-inch wedges or cubes. Consistent sizing is important so they all cook at roughly the same rate, preventing some from being undercooked or overcooked.
Tossing with oil and spice
Once the Brussels sprouts and potatoes are prepped, it’s time to coat them with the right blend of oil and spices to enhance their natural flavors and encourage crispy edges. In a large mixing bowl, combine the cut Brussels sprouts and potato wedges. Drizzle them generously with good quality olive oil, ensuring all pieces are lightly coated. Then, sprinkle them with salt, freshly ground black pepper, and for an extra layer of flavor that ties into our chicken, a pinch of smoked paprika. Toss everything together vigorously until the vegetables are evenly coated with the oil and spices. Roasting Veggies to Golden Perfection
Spreading on baking sheet
Achieving perfectly roasted, crispy vegetables requires proper spacing on the baking sheet. Once your Brussels sprouts and potato wedges are thoroughly tossed with olive oil and spices, spread them out in a single layer on a large baking sheet. It’s crucial not to overcrowd the pan. If the vegetables are too close together, they will steam instead of roast, resulting in a soggy texture rather than the desired crispiness. If necessary, use two baking sheets to ensure ample space between each piece. This allows hot air to circulate freely around the vegetables, promoting even cooking and optimal browning, which is essential for a flavorful weeknight dinner.
Achieving crispy texture
To get that coveted golden-brown and crispy texture, roast the vegetables in a preheated oven at a relatively high temperature, typically around 400°F (200°C). The exact roasting time will depend on your oven and the size of your vegetable pieces, but generally, it takes about 25-35 minutes. Halfway through the cooking time, toss the vegetables gently with a spatula to ensure all sides get an opportunity to crisp up. You’ll know they’re done when the Brussels sprouts have slightly charred edges and the potatoes are fork-tender with golden, crispy skins. Assemble Smoked Paprika Chicken Alfredo Meal
Slicing cooked chicken
Once your smoked paprika chicken breasts have rested, it’s time to prepare them for serving. Place each chicken breast on a cutting board and slice it against the grain into ½-inch thick pieces. Slicing against the grain helps to ensure maximum tenderness and makes each bite more enjoyable. Modifying tahini amounts
The tahini is a key component of our unique alfredo, offering a distinctive nutty depth. However, its flavor can be quite assertive for some. If you’re new to tahini or prefer a milder nuttiness, start with a smaller amount, perhaps half of what’s recommended, and taste the sauce before adding more. If you crave that deep, earthy sesame flavor, feel free to increase the tahini to your preference. Adjusting the tahini also impacts the sauce’s thickness, so you might need to thin it slightly with a splash of warm chicken broth or milk if you add too much.
